- Hornby Hobbies x One:One Collection Open Weekend 2026
Saturday 15 August and Sunday 16 August 2026
Overview
Join us for a weekend of fun at the Hornby Hobbies x One:One Collection Open Weekend
Join us for a weekend of full-size fun, hands-on activities and model magic at Hornby's WonderWorks and The One:One Collection in Margate!
Whether you're a lifelong enthusiast or simply looking for a great day out with the family, Hornby Hobbies' summer open weekend promises something for everyone. Held across two days in the historic home of Hornby, this event is packed with interactive displays, iconic brands, model railways, slot car racing and a rare chance to get up close to full-size trains and half-scale classic cars.
This special event is being held in conjunction with Southeastern, in celebration of 100 years of the Thanet railway stations.
WHAT TO EXPECT
The One:One Collection
Your ticket includes a preview of One:One Collection - packed with full-size heritage locomotives, large-scale engineering models, and a working O gauge layout. Step inside to see the mighty Black 5 and iconic Royal Scot locomotives, Churchill's funeral carriage, and the original Euston station departure boards. The space also features a working O gauge layout and large-scale engineered. It's an unmissable experience for anyone curious about the scale and story of Britain's railways.
